Cable tray expansion joints must comply with NEC Section 300-7(b), which mandates the use of expansion joints to accommodate thermal expansion and contraction of raceways and cables . NEMA VE 1 provides detailed recommendations for metallic cable tray systems, including placement, gap settings, and environmental considerations . These standards ensure long-term system stability and prevent structural stress or cable damage.
